Микрофон в приложениях — причины неисправности и методы устранения проблем

Микрофон является одним из наиболее важных элементов современных мобильных приложений. Благодаря нему пользователи могут делать голосовые записи, осуществлять аудио- и видео-звонки, а также использовать голосовые команды для управления приложением. Однако, несмотря на свою важность, использование микрофона может вызывать ряд проблем, требующих особых решений.

Одной из основных проблем, с которой сталкиваются разработчики приложений, связанных с микрофоном, является управление доступом к нему. Ведь пользователям приложения требуется предоставить разрешение на использование микрофона, что может вызвать у них недоверие и сомнения. В этом случае важно предоставить пользователю объяснение о том, для чего требуется доступ к микрофону, а также заверить его в том, что данные, записываемые с помощью микрофона, будут использованы только в рамках приложения и не будут переданы третьим лицам.

Еще одной распространенной проблемой, специфичной для микрофона в приложениях, является неправильное распознавание голосовых команд. Это может быть связано со множеством факторов, включая шумные условия, неправильную подстройку микрофона и неточности в алгоритмах распознавания речи. Для решения этой проблемы необходимо проводить тестирование микрофона в различных условиях и внедрять алгоритмы, позволяющие улучшить точность распознавания голосовых команд.

Проблемы использования микрофона в приложениях

  • Низкое качество звука: Наиболее распространенной проблемой является низкое качество звука, которое может быть вызвано различными факторами, включая плохое соединение или плохую настройку микрофона. Это может привести к тому, что голос будет слабо слышен или искажен.
  • Шумы и помехи: Использование микрофона в шумной среде или рядом с другими электронными устройствами может вызывать появление нежелательных шумов и помех на записи. Это может значительно ухудшить качество звука и затруднить его воспроизведение.
  • Проблемы с уровнем громкости: Микрофон может быть настроен слишком громко или тихо, что также может влиять на качество звука. Если микрофон слишком тихо, записанный звук может быть едва слышен, а при слишком высоком уровне громкости звук может искажаться и приводить к неудобствам для пользователей.
  • Неоднозначность команд голосового управления: Приложения, которые используют голосовое управление, могут сталкиваться с проблемой определения команд пользователя. Это может быть вызвано проблемами с распознаванием речи или различными акцентами и диалектами, что может затруднять правильное выполнение команд.

Для решения этих проблем разработчики приложений должны уделить особое внимание настройке микрофона и его окружения, а также использованию алгоритмов шумоподавления и распознавания речи. Зачастую требуется проводить тестирование и оптимизацию процесса записи и воспроизведения звука, чтобы обеспечить наилучшее качество звука и пользовательский опыт.

Нежелание пользователей давать доступ к микрофону

  • Опасение потери конфиденциальности. Микрофон — это важное устройство, способное записывать и передавать аудиофайлы. Пользователи могут опасаться, что их разговоры или звуки вокруг них могут быть записаны без их ведома и использованы в недобрыйчеловеческих целях.
  • Сомнение в необходимости доступа. Некоторым пользователям может показаться, что запрашиваемый доступ к микрофону не является необходимым для работы приложения или функции, которую они хотят использовать. В связи с этим, они могут отказывать в доступе, чтобы избежать возможного риска или неудобства.
  • Негативный опыт использования. Если у пользователя ранее был негативный опыт использования приложений, которые имеют доступ к микрофону, он может быть скептически настроен относительно предоставления согласия.
  • Недостаток информации и прозрачности. Некоторые пользователи могут не понимать, почему приложению нужен доступ к микрофону и какая информация будет записана или передана. Если разработчики не предоставляют достаточно информации о целях использования микрофона и меры безопасности, это также может стать причиной отказа.

Однако существуют способы решения проблемы нежелания пользователей давать доступ к микрофону:

  1. Объяснение необходимости доступа. Разработчики могут подробно описать в понятной форме, зачем приложению нужен доступ к микрофону и что будет сделано с записанными аудиоданными. Предоставление полной информации сокращает опасения пользователей и помогает им принять решение о предоставлении доступа.
  2. Согласие на использование. В некоторых приложениях можно добавить функциональность, позволяющую пользователям выбрать, каким образом и когда будет использоваться микрофон. Предоставление такой возможности помогает снизить опасения пользователей и повышает уровень их доверия.
  3. Строгое соблюдение приватности. Разработчики могут обещать и гарантировать, что аудиофайлы, записанные с помощью микрофона, будут зашифрованы и храниться в безопасном месте. Обязательное соблюдение мер безопасности и защиты личной информации поможет убедить пользователей в необходимости предоставления доступа.
  4. Персонализация пользовательского опыта. Пользователям может быть интересно узнать, что использование микрофона поможет повысить функциональность и удобство работы приложения, позволит лучше адаптировать его к их потребностям. Предоставление информации о том, какие преимущества получат пользователи при предоставлении доступа к микрофону, может увеличить их вероятность согласиться на это.

В целом, разработчики приложений должны быть готовыми ответить на опасения пользователей и предоставить им достаточно информации, чтобы помочь им сделать обоснованное решение относительно доступа к микрофону. При этом необходимо строго соблюдать приватность данных и обязательно соблюдать все меры безопасности, чтобы не нарушать доверие пользователей и не подвергать их личную информацию риску.

Ошибки микрофона при записи

Многие приложения, использующие микрофон для записи аудио, могут столкнуться с различными проблемами при работе с этим устройством. Ошибки микрофона могут возникать по разным причинам и вызывать некачественную запись или полный отказ в его работе. В данном разделе рассмотрим некоторые из наиболее распространенных ошибок, которые могут возникать при использовании микрофона в приложениях.

  1. Низкое качество записи. Эта проблема может быть вызвана плохим качеством самого микрофона или ошибками при его подключении к устройству. Для решения данной проблемы необходимо проверить настройки записи в приложении, а также убедиться в исправности самого микрофона.
  2. Шумы и искажения. При записи звука микрофон может захватывать не только нужный звук, но и нежелательные шумы, которые могут существенно исказить качество записи. Для уменьшения шумов и искажений можно воспользоваться шумоподавляющими алгоритмами или использовать наушники с микрофоном для записи, чтобы уменьшить попадание внешних звуков.
  3. Пропуск записи или потеря звука. Иногда микрофон может перестать записывать звук или пропускать его во время записи. Причиной может быть неправильное подключение микрофона или неисправность самого устройства. В таком случае рекомендуется проверить подключение микрофона и, при необходимости, заменить его.
  4. Регулировка громкости. Иногда микрофон может записывать звук слишком громко или слишком тихо, что может усложнить дальнейшую обработку аудио. Для решения данной проблемы обычно используются настройки громкости в приложении или на устройстве.
  5. Отсутствие звука. Если приложение не записывает звук вообще, то причиной может быть неправильное подключение микрофона или его поломка. Для решения данной проблемы рекомендуется проверить подключение микрофона и, при необходимости, заменить его.

Важно отметить, что многие ошибки микрофона могут быть связаны с неправильной настройкой приложения или неисправностью самого устройства. При возникновении проблем с микрофоном рекомендуется проверить настройки приложения, убедиться в исправности микрофона и, при необходимости, обратиться к специалистам для ремонта или замены устройства.

Использование микрофона в шумной среде

Какие же существуют решения для работы микрофона в шумной среде?

Во-первых, приложение может использовать алгоритмы шумоподавления, которые позволяют убрать фоновые шумы и улучшить качество звука. Эти алгоритмы могут быть реализованы как аппаратно, встроенными в микрофон системами шумоподавления, так и программно, через специальные библиотеки и алгоритмы обработки звука.

Во-вторых, для уменьшения внешних шумов можно использовать направленные микрофоны. Они снимают звук только из определенного направления и игнорируют остальные звуковые источники. Такие микрофоны помогают значительно улучшить разборчивость речи и звуковую передачу.

Также микрофон в шумной среде может быть настроен на уровень громкости, что позволит снизить влияние окружающих шумов. Но это может привести к тому, что слабые звуки будут теряться. Такой подход требует балансирования громкости и может быть оптимальным для определенных условий работы.

Еще одним решением для работы микрофона в шумной среде является изменение частотного диапазона. Это помогает улучшить разборчивость речи и сделать звук чище. Но необходимо учитывать, что это может снизить общую качество передачи и привести к потере некоторых звуковых деталей.

Использование гибридных подходов, комбинирующих несколько технологий, может быть наиболее эффективным решением. Например, встроенный микрофон с шумоподавляющим алгоритмом, работающий вместе с направленными микрофонами и с настраиваемыми параметрами громкости.

ПреимуществаНедостатки
Улучшение распознавания речиПотеря деталей звука
Уменьшение фоновых шумовСложность настройки
Повышение качества звукаВозможность потери слабых звуков

Борьба со шумом в работе микрофона не может быть идеальной, но с помощью различных решений можно существенно улучшить его работу. Подбор оптимального подхода зависит от конкретных условий использования и требований приложения.

Сложности с качеством звука при записи

Одной из причин низкого качества звука может быть плохая аппаратная реализация микрофона. Дешевые микрофоны или встроенные микрофоны в смартфонах и планшетах не всегда способны обеспечить высокую четкость и чистоту звука. В таких случаях, даже установка лучшего программного обеспечения или оптимизация кода не решит проблему.

Еще одной проблемой может быть неправильная настройка микрофона или его позиционирование. Неправильное местоположение микрофона, например, слишком далеко от источника звука или слишком близко к нему, может привести к искажениям звучания или затуханию голоса.

Важным аспектом при записи звука является выбор формата записи и настроек параметров записи. Некоторые форматы компрессии аудио могут потерять качество звука при сохранении или передаче данных. Кроме того, неправильные настройки громкости, частотного диапазона или битрейта могут также влиять на качество записанного звука.

Для решения проблем с качеством звука при записи можно использовать несколько подходов. Во-первых, необходимо убедиться в правильной работе аппаратной части — проверить микрофон на другом устройстве или заменить его на более качественную модель. Во-вторых, следует провести настройку микрофона — определить оптимальное местоположение и проверить настройки параметров записи. И, наконец, выбор правильного формата записи и оптимизация настроек также помогут улучшить качество звука.

ПроблемаПричинаРешение
Низкое качество звукаПлохая аппаратная реализация микрофонаЗамена микрофона на более качественную модель
Искажения звучанияНеправильное местоположение микрофонаОпределение оптимального местоположения микрофона и его настройка
Потеря качества звукаНекорректные настройки формата записи или параметровВыбор правильного формата записи и оптимизация настроек записи

Отсутствие микрофона у некоторых устройств

Отсутствие микрофона может стать серьезным препятствием для работы многих приложений, особенно тех, которые требуют распознавания голоса или аудиозаписи. Какие же решения могут быть предложены в такой ситуации?

Во-первых, разработчики могут предусмотреть альтернативные способы ввода звука. Например, приложение может поддерживать использование внешних микрофонов или вести процесс записи аудио через встроенный микрофон другого устройства в паре с приложением на первом устройстве.

Во-вторых, можно предоставить пользователям возможность использования текстового ввода вместо голосового. Это позволит пользователям без микрофона всё равно использовать приложение и взаимодействовать с ним посредством набора текста. Тем более, что сейчас в большинстве устройств есть встроенные средства распознавания речи, которые позволяют вводить текст голосом, а затем конвертировать его в текстовый формат.

Наконец, третьим решением может быть просто отсутствие опций, требующих использования микрофона, в приложении для устройств без такого аппаратного компонента. Таким образом, можно предоставить возможность использования базовых функций приложения даже на тех устройствах, которые не имеют микрофона.

В итоге, отсутствие микрофона у некоторых устройств не является неразрешимой проблемой для разработчиков. Необходимо учитывать специфику каждого устройства и предоставлять различные варианты ввода звука для обеспечения максимальной доступности и функциональности приложения вне зависимости от наличия микрофона.

Решения проблем использования микрофона в приложениях

Проблема 1: Низкое качество звука

Одной из основных проблем, с которыми сталкиваются разработчики приложений, является низкое качество звука, записываемого с помощью микрофона. Часто качество звука может быть недостаточным для получения четкой и понятной записи голоса. Для решения этой проблемы важно использовать микрофоны высокого качества, которые способны записывать звук с минимальными искажениями. Также можно использовать алгоритмы обработки звука, которые позволяют повысить качество записи.

Проблема 2: Разные уровни громкости

Еще одной проблемой, с которой можно столкнуться при использовании микрофона в приложениях, являются разные уровни громкости записываемого звука. При разговоре некоторые звуки могут быть записаны слишком громко, в то время как другие звуки могут быть записаны слишком тихо. Для решения этой проблемы можно использовать алгоритмы автоматической регулировки громкости, которые позволяют подстроить уровень громкости записи в зависимости от окружающих условий.

Проблема 3: Шумы и побочные звуки

Шумы и другие побочные звуки могут быть проблемой при использовании микрофона в приложениях. Это может быть вызвано окружающей средой, плохим качеством микрофона или другими факторами. Для решения этой проблемы можно использовать алгоритмы шумоподавления и фильтрации, которые позволяют удалить шумы и побочные звуки, сохраняя при этом четкость записи голоса.

Оцените статью